7DM手游网-一个绿色下载空间! 登录| 注册 退出
当前位置: 首页 > 资讯 > 攻略

区块链服务器,构建安全、高效的数据网络

来源:小编 更新:2024-09-22 09:36:13

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

深入解析区块链服务器:构建安全、高效的数据网络

区块链技术作为一种分布式账本技术,已经在金融、供应链、物联网等多个领域展现出巨大的应用潜力。而区块链服务器作为区块链技术实现的基础设施,其性能、安全性和可扩展性至关重要。本文将深入解析区块链服务器,探讨其构建原则、关键技术以及应用场景。

标签:区块链服务器,基础设施,分布式账本

一、区块链服务器的定义与作用

区块链服务器是指运行区块链软件的计算机设备,负责存储、验证和传播区块链数据。在区块链网络中,服务器之间通过共识机制保持数据一致性,共同维护整个网络的稳定运行。区块链服务器的作用主要包括:

1. 存储区块链数据:服务器存储着整个区块链网络的历史交易记录,包括区块头、区块体和交易信息等。

2. 验证交易:服务器对交易进行验证,确保交易符合网络规则,防止双花等安全问题。

3. 同步数据:服务器之间通过共识机制同步数据,保持整个网络的一致性。

4. 提供接口:服务器为开发者提供API接口,方便应用层调用区块链服务。

标签:定义,作用,区块链网络

二、区块链服务器的构建原则

构建区块链服务器需要遵循以下原则:

1. 安全性:服务器应具备强大的安全防护能力,防止恶意攻击和数据泄露。

2. 可靠性:服务器应具备高可用性,确保网络稳定运行。

3. 可扩展性:服务器应支持横向扩展,满足不断增长的网络规模。

4. 易用性:服务器应提供友好的操作界面和丰富的API接口,方便用户使用。

标签:构建原则,安全性,可靠性

三、区块链服务器的关键技术

区块链服务器涉及多项关键技术,以下列举其中几个重要技术:

1. 共识机制:共识机制是区块链服务器实现数据一致性的关键,如工作量证明(PoW)、权益证明(PoS)等。

2. 加密算法:加密算法用于保护区块链数据的安全,如SHA-256、ECDSA等。

3. 分布式存储:分布式存储技术将数据分散存储在多个服务器上,提高数据可靠性和安全性。

4. 智能合约:智能合约是一种自动执行合约条款的程序,实现自动化交易和合约执行。

标签:关键技术,共识机制,加密算法

四、区块链服务器的应用场景

区块链服务器在多个领域具有广泛的应用场景,以下列举几个典型应用:

1. 金融领域:区块链服务器可以应用于数字货币、跨境支付、供应链金融等场景,提高金融交易的安全性和效率。

2. 供应链管理:区块链服务器可以应用于供应链溯源、防伪、物流跟踪等场景,提高供应链透明度和可信度。

3. 物联网:区块链服务器可以应用于物联网设备身份认证、数据安全、设备管理等场景,提高物联网系统的安全性。

4. 人工智能:区块链服务器可以应用于人工智能数据共享、模型训练、知识产权保护等场景,促进人工智能产业发展。

标签:应用场景,金融领域,供应链管理

五、总结

区块链服务器作为区块链技术实现的基础设施,其性能、安全性和可扩展性至关重要。本文从定义、构建原则、关键技术以及应用场景等方面对区块链服务器进行了深入解析,旨在为读者提供全面了解区块链服务器的知识。随着区块链技术的不断发展,区块链服务器将在更多领域发挥重要作用,推动社会进步。


玩家评论

此处添加你的第三方评论代码